Hair Loss Stage – 

Before we delve into the details, we need to understand the pattern of hair loss. The cycle of hair growth undergoes 3 stages. Your hair will stop growing and tends to separate from its follicle right from the catagen phase. This lasted for nearly 10 days. The second stage is telogen. Here is where the follicle rests for like 3 months and hair comes out. The third stage is the anagen one. It is where new hair gets into the same follicle.  

Now if by any chance the cycle is disrupted or an injury occurs to the hair follicle, hair falls out at a faster pace. It becomes replaced in terms of receding hairline, thinning hair spots or might be even general hair thinning.

1. Onion

Ingredients –  

  • Extract onion oil
  • Chop onions
  • Use 1 cotton ball 

Benefits – 

  • Onions are rich in sulfur. 
  • Stimulates collagen production that enhances your skin health as well as your hair health. 
  • Helps in treating patch alopecia areata. It is an autoimmune condition where the body attacks the hair follicles and tends to cause hair loss in different parts of the body. 

How to apply? 

  • Chop the onions and place them in the juicer. Extract the juice. 
  • With the help of a cotton ball, dip the ball in the juice. 
  • Apply the juice onto the scalp. Let it sit in for 10 min to an hour. 
  • Rinse it off with a shampoo of your choice.

3. Apple Cider Vinegar

Ingredients – 

  • Apple cider vinegar
  • Bowl of water
  • Spray bottle

Benefits – 

  • The presence of acetic acid balances the pH level of hair. It brings the health back to the damaged hair or hair thinning process. 
  • It has antimicrobial properties that help in controlling the bacteria or fungi which may lead to scalp or hair issues. 
  • It is also rich in vitamins C and B and alpha-hydroxy acid. It also has anti-inflammatory properties for removing dandruff and exfoliating scalp skin. 

How to apply? 

  • Mix 2-3 tbsp of apple cider vinegar in 16 ounces of water. 
  • You may store the mixture in the spray bottle for regular use (if you want). 
  • After shampooing and conditioning your hair, pour the mixture on your hair properly that directly works on your scalp. 
  • Rinse it out well. Try doing it every time you wash your hair.
